From Passive Apps to Real-Time Collaborative Learning

The pandemic exposed the limitations of static, app-based learning, where students often engaged in isolated, screen-centric tasks. Early educational apps emphasized content delivery—video lectures and quizzes—but lacked interactivity. As schools moved to remote models, technology evolved rapidly: latency dropped, interfaces became more intuitive, and tools enabled synchronous participation. Platforms integrated live chat, breakout rooms, and real-time polling, transforming passive consumption into active collaboration. For example, tools like Zoom and Microsoft Teams adapted to support instant peer interaction, while platforms such as Nearpod allowed teachers to guide live, interactive lessons with embedded engagement features.

Interfaces optimized for real-time participation

Latency became a critical barrier; even a one-second delay disrupted flow and reduced engagement. Developers responded with smarter routing protocols and edge computing, ensuring smoother video and audio transmission. Interface design prioritized simplicity and immediacy—drag-and-drop collaboration, instant feedback loops, and visual cues for participation helped maintain momentum. This shift mirrored broader changes in user expectations: learners demanded responsiveness, mirroring the real-time nature of digital communication beyond school.

Gesture and Voice: Bridging Physical Distance

Beyond video, emerging gesture and voice technologies began to close the gap between digital and physical presence. Voice-enabled tools allowed students to ask questions aloud, triggering immediate teacher responses or AI-driven clarifications. Gesture recognition, though nascent, enabled nonverbal cues—nodding, pointing—to be interpreted in real time, preserving the richness of face-to-face interaction. These innovations were especially vital in supporting neurodiverse learners and those with limited literacy, offering alternative pathways to engagement that transcended traditional screen-based models.

Adaptive Algorithms Personalize Learning Journeys

With real-time data flowing from every interaction, adaptive learning algorithms matured beyond basic recommendations. Driven by pandemic data surges, AI systems began predicting student performance with increasing accuracy. Dynamic content scaffolding emerged—curricula adjusted instantly based on individual progress, offering richer challenges for advanced learners and targeted support for those struggling. Platforms like Khan Academy and Duolingo refined their models during this period, embedding micro-adaptations that mirrored responsive teaching in physical classrooms.

  • Real-time analytics enabled immediate intervention, reducing dropout risks in online learning.
  • Machine learning models identified patterns in engagement, helping educators tailor support.
  • Algorithmic scaffolding evolved to balance autonomy and guidance, preserving learner agency.

Bridging Equity Through Inclusive Tech Evolution

While innovation accelerated, the pandemic laid bare persistent inequities. Yet, it also spurred a global push for inclusive design. Low-bandwidth solutions emerged, expanding access to underserved regions. Developers prioritized culturally responsive content, integrating local languages, contexts, and narratives. Policy efforts intensified to ensure devices and connectivity reached marginalized communities, setting a precedent for sustainable, equitable tech integration beyond emergency response.
